Detailing Question- Back window next to center brake light
 
Thoroughly cleaned my BRZ a few days ago. I was unable to clean the area of the back window that touches the center rear brake light. There were a couple of dead bugs back there along with some film that accumulated on the glass that surrounds the brake light. Any suggestions?

To get anything out of there some compressed air works really well, and sometimes fishing line to get stuff out that's stuck. I'll also get a thin microfiber cloth and floss it in between the light and the glass to clean the glass if it's smudged somehow. Hope that helps!
